Runbook: if the Bellgrove timetable solver stalls past 90 seconds, check the constraint pre-pass for unsatisfiable room-capacity pairs before restarting. A restart without clearing the hint cache reproduces the stall. Reviewers should confirm the cache-invalidation patch is present in the running build, identified by the token below.

pipeline stamp: htk21_86b657ac0aa916a9af17f

## Authentication

All calls to Splitgate (the A/B assignment service) require a bearer token. Support tooling uses the shared read-only credential; it can fetch assignments and experiment metadata but cannot mutate allocations. Pass it in the Authorization header on every request. If you get a 401, the token has likely rotated — check the escalation channel before filing a ticket. Do not paste the credential into customer-facing replies. For local troubleshooting against the staging cluster, use the key below.

gateway credential: vxb4-QTMv

### Why does the linter keep yelling about my SQL files?

Short answer: the Burrowdale style rules are stricter than vanilla sqlfluff. Uppercase keywords, explicit JOIN conditions, no `SELECT *` outside scratch schemas, and every migration needs a reversible down script. Yes, it's picky — it saved us twice during the ledger migration, so it stays. If you're on-call and a pipeline is blocked on lint, you can use the override tag, but file a ticket so someone fixes it properly. The full rule list with examples lives on this page.

wiki page, tagef-bajog: https://grafana.nelvrocorp.corp/projects/pages/display/fa238a928afe

Handover — webhook delivery retries (Pingloft)

Retries are exponential: 30s base, doubling to a 1-hour cap, eight attempts total, then dead-letter. Deliveries are at-least-once, so downstream consumers must dedupe on event ID. The stuck-queue alert fires if the oldest pending item exceeds two hours. Nothing is currently paging. The live retry configuration is set out below.

config for kajog-tadug:
[casax]
port = 11211
region = west-3
host = casax.nelvroworks.internal
timeout_ms = 5000
retries = 7